Which of the following is a key function of an electrician's mate (EM)?

Explanation:
The role of an electrician's mate (EM) fundamentally revolves around supporting licensed electricians in various tasks related to the maintenance and repair of electrical systems. This involves assisting with hands-on tasks such as wiring, troubleshooting electrical problems, and ensuring that safety protocols are adhered to during all work. The training received prepares EMs to work alongside experienced electricians, where they can enhance their skills and contribute effectively to the work environment. In contrast, designing electrical systems is typically the responsibility of licensed engineers or electricians with advanced qualifications and experience, not the primary focus for EMs. High-voltage equipment installation also falls under the domain of licensed electricians who have the specific training and authorization to handle such tasks safely. Additionally, managing project budgets involves a level of administrative oversight and financial management that is generally beyond the scope of duties assigned to an electrician's mate. Therefore, assisting licensed electricians is indeed the key function of this role, emphasizing the importance of teamwork in the electrical field.
